Dangers Associated With LASIK
Several individuals undertaking LASIK surgery are mainly worried concerning possible dangers associated with the procedure. While LASIK is a safe and efficient treatment for vision Correction, like any procedure, it does come with some risks.
One of the most typical threats connected with LASIK consist of completely dry eyes, glow, halos, and problem driving at night in the immediate postoperative duration. These signs and symptoms are usually short-lived and enhance as the eyes heal.
In unusual situations, more major difficulties such as infection, corneal flap issues, and vision loss can occur, yet the possibility of these complications is incredibly low when the surgical procedure is carried out by an experienced and experienced ophthalmologist. It is very important to discuss these dangers with your doctor throughout the examination to ensure you have a clear understanding of what to expect.
